The entry and tributeWhen Gaga enters the stage in the voluminous red gown and starts performing ‘Bloody Mary,’ it’s a sacred experience. As the skirt slowly opens up when she’s at the top, the caged dancers are revealed, enhancing the high-octane pop experience. She follows it with her other hits, ‘Abracadabra,’ ‘Judas, and ‘Scheiße,’ setting the perfect tone.
After giving a glimpse of her 2010 era, the 39-year-old welcomes the audience by saying, “Welcome to Mayhem. Welcome to the opera house. This is my house.” A few moments later, it’s the ‘P-p-p-Poker Face’ moment with an extravagant chess game.
The MayhemWelcoming the ‘Mayhem’ era, the skeletons, the white dress and human remains make the perfect ambience. Giving a nothing-like-before vibe, the skeletons start to dance around her. Moreover, the gothic diva gets a huge skull on the stage and spins around the runway with the screams that highlight an eerie Gaga mode.
